Nestlé, the world’s largest food and nutrition company with operations in 200 countries and 350,000+ employees, faced decentralized, human-only translation processes that caused high costs and long delivery times across consumer, employee and Global Business Services communications. To scale volume, reduce costs and protect sensitive content, Nestlé engaged SYSTRAN and its Pure Neural® Server machine translation solution.

SYSTRAN deployed its Pure Neural® Server in a private cloud and integrated it with Nestlé’s XTM TMS, giving about 3,000 users access to MT in 32 languages across seven Global Business Services locations. With MT-only workflows for document understanding (including PDFs and scanned files) plus MT + post-editing via seamless TMS integration, SYSTRAN enabled faster, centralized translations, increased translation throughput, measurable cost savings, GDPR-compliant data handling, customizable glossaries and advanced usage reporting.
